Compared with the local labor market

Paralegal Specialist pay vs. the United States

Across all employers in the United States, the median wage for Paralegals and Legal Assistants — about 392,880 people — is $62,890. Department of Housing and Urban Developm pays a median base salary of $104,788 for this role, 67% above that figureabove the 90th percentile of local pay for the occupation.

The bar is the range of annual wages for Paralegals and Legal Assistants across every employer in the United States, from the 10th to the 90th percentile, with the middle 50% highlighted. The marker shows Department of Housing and Urban Developm’s median base salary for this role. Both figures are base pay only.

Median total compensation for this role at Department of Housing and Urban Developm is $104,788, which includes overtime and employer-paid benefits. The benchmark above excludes both, so total compensation is deliberately not compared against it.

Benchmark: U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(May 2025). BLS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) covers all employers in the area — private, non-profit, and government alike — so this is a comparison against the whole local labor market for the occupation, not against private-sector pay. OEWS wages are straight-time pay and exclude overtime, shift differentials, and employer-paid benefits, so the government figure shown here is base pay on the same basis. Total compensation is not comparable to it. Job titles are matched to the closest standard occupation, so the comparison is between similar work rather than an identical job classification.
